“Show Me the Science” Podcast: Can boosting the immune system, rather than suppressing it, work against COVID-19?

This episode of Show Me the Science details new research from scientists at Washington University School of Medicine in St. Louis suggests that the immune systems of such patients can′t do enough to protect them from the virus. The researchers are proposing boosting the activity of immune cells to treat some patients with COVID-19.
